Judge Allows Trump to Share Medicaid Data with ICE

1/6/2026

26 4

1 of 1

Story summary
  • On December 29, 2025, a federal judge allowed U.S. President Donald Trump’s administration to resume sharing Medicaid patient data with U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ement, effective January 6, 2026.
  • The ruling follows a lawsuit by 20 states, including California, to block the data sharing.
  • The agreement allows ICE to access names, addresses, and Medicaid IDs to aid deportation efforts.
  • California Attorney General Rob Bonta expressed disappointment in the ruling.
